Agnes Scott College

Agnes Scott College logoAgnes Scott College is a private Presbyterian liberal arts college for women in Decatur, Georgia—just six miles from downtown Atlanta. At Agnes Scott, more than 1,100 students choose from 30 undergraduate majors and minors, 150+ study abroad programs in 50+ countries, and over 60 clubs and organizations on campus. The College also offers a unique SUMMIT core curriculum that focuses on applying classroom learning to real-world experiences through hands-on opportunities.

Barry University

Barry University logoBarry University is a private Catholic liberal arts university in Miami Shores, Florida. The University enrolls more than 3,100 undergraduate students and offers them 100+ academic programs, including majors in subjects such as business, communications, computer science, education, health, law, and more. Barry also has an active campus community with 50+ organizations to choose from and 12 varsity athletic teams with 28 NCAA Division II championship titles.

Barton College

Barton College logoBarton College is a private liberal arts college in Wilson, North Carolina—about 45 miles from Raleigh. Providing students with a strong academic focus and opportunities for leadership development, Barton offers more than 40 majors and programs through the Schools of Allied Health & Sports Studies, Business, Education, Humanities, Nursing, Sciences, and Visual, Performing & Communication Arts. Barton students benefit from average class sizes of 17 students, NCAA Division II athletic teams, and average financial aid packages of over $20,000.

Bridgewater College

Bridgewater College logoBridgewater College is a private Christian liberal arts college in Bridgewater, Virginia—near Harrisonburg, Charlottesville, Richmond, and Washington, DC. Joining a student body of nearly 1,500, new Bridgewater students can choose from 55 undergraduate majors and minors as well as study abroad programs and May Term travel opportunities. It’s easy to get involved on campus with 60+ clubs, organizations, and honor societies to join as well as intramural sports teams and entertainment organized by the Campus Engagement and Activity Team.

Charleston Southern University

Charleston Southern University logoCharleston Southern University is a private Christian liberal arts university in Charleston, South Carolina. With a 12:1 student-faculty ratio, the University offers more than 60 undergraduate programs to a student body of 2,700+. Student-athletes can compete on 16 Division I athletic teams, and vibrant campus ministries and student organizations provide opportunities to serve at the local, national, and global levels.

Covenant College

Covenant College logoCovenant College is a Presbyterian liberal arts college on Lookout Mountain in Georgia—just across the state line from Chattanooga, Tennessee. With an enrollment of just under 1,000 students, the College provides a rigorous and religiously integrated education through 27 majors and numerous minors, pre-professional programs, and certificates. Covenant also offers the Center for Calling and Career to help students incorporate faith into their career preparation.

Eckerd College

Eckerd College logoEckerd College is a private coeducational liberal arts college in St. Petersburg, Florida, featuring a spectacular mile of waterfront on the Gulf Coast. Enrolling approximately 2,000 students, the College offers 42 majors and 52 minors, with distinct strengths in Marine Science and Environmental Studies. Undergraduates benefit from a unique three-week Autumn Term orientation and extensive study abroad opportunities. Eckerd is also nationally recognized for its pet-friendly campus and commitment to service.

Elon University

Elon University logoElon University is a selective independent liberal arts university in Elon, North Carolina—east of Greensboro and northwest of Raleigh/Durham. At Elon, more than 6,000 undergraduates are enrolled in over 70 academic programs and can get involved in 280+ campus clubs and organizations. Students can study away for a one-month Winter Term, a semester, a summer, or a whole academic year with 100+ study abroad and Study USA programs.

Lees-McRae College

Lees-McRae College logoLees-McRae College is a private Presbyterian liberal arts college in Banner Elk, North Carolina. The College provides a dynamic array of 27 undergraduate majors and 26 minors, with strengths in fields such as Business Administration, Wildlife Biology, Nursing, and Performing Arts. With over 25 clubs and organizations—including leadership programs, outdoor recreation, and service opportunities—Lees-McRae students can find countless ways to connect with others and make a difference.

Lynn University

Lynn University logoLynn University is a private liberal arts university in Boca Raton, Florida—23 miles from Fort Lauderdale and Palm Beach and 50 miles from Miami. At Lynn, more than 3,200 students come from 45 states and 101 countries to pursue 110 undergraduate and graduate programs. The University is nationally known for its Dialogues core curriculum and award-winning iPad®-powered learning program.

Methodist University

Methodist University logoMethodist University is a private Christian liberal arts college in Fayetteville, North Carolina—60 miles south of Raleigh. At MU, approximately 2,100 students have the advantage of small classes—averaging fewer than 20 students—in more than 80 majors, minors, and concentration programs. Outside of the classroom, students can get involved in almost 100 clubs and organizations, 20 NCAA Division III athletic teams, honor societies, recreational sports, and more.

Toccoa Falls College

Toccoa Falls College logoToccoa Falls College is a Christian Bible and liberal arts college in Toccoa Falls, Georgia—in the fo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ains. The College offers 32 majors, 15 student-led organizations, and a scenic campus with numerous opportunities for outdoor activities to a student body of more than 2,000 students. TFC’s low 16:1 student-faculty ratio and average class size of 17 facilitate an open-door policy and excellent one-on-one advising from faculty, providing students with an intimate and intentional experience in the classroom.

Union University

Union University logoUnion University is a private Baptist university in Jackson, Tennessee—80 miles east of Memphis—with branch campuses in Germantown and Hendersonville. With a total enrollment of over 3,100 students and a 10:1 student-faculty ratio, Union offers more than 100 programs of study, with distinctive options in Cybersecurity and Zoology. Students can also engage with 90+ student organizations, NCAA Division II athletic teams, and a rich residence life experience.

University of Richmond

 University of Richmond logoThe University of Richmond is a private liberal arts university in Richmond, Virginia—just six miles from the state capital’s downtown. Richmond’s more than 3,100 undergraduates benefit from having over 60 undergraduate majors and concentrations—including Philosophy, Politics, Economics, and Law (PPEL), Leadership Studies, and more—as well as 175+ clubs and organizations to choose from. The University also offers the Richmond Guarantee, which ensures every undergraduate up to $5,000 in funding for a summer internship or research project.

University of Tennessee Southern

University of Tennessee Southern logoUniversity of Tennessee Southern is a public liberal arts university in Pulaski, Tennessee. Enrolling a close-knit student body, the University offers more than 30 undergraduate and graduate programs in fields like business, education, health sciences, and the arts. Students benefit from a personalized 13:1 student-faculty ratio and an average class size of just 13 students. Outside the classroom, the campus community features various student organizations, leadership opportunities, and 19 varsity NAIA athletic teams.
